Lenz Moser

Lenz Moser produces wines in Niederösterreich's Weinland region, where continental climate and diverse terroirs shape the character of both red and white varietals. The winery's portfolio centers on two distinct expressions: Mariage Carpe Diem, a Bordeaux-style blend of Cabernet Franc, Cabernet Sauvignon, and Merlot, and Reserve Carpe Diem, built from Grüner Veltliner, Austria's signature white grape. A third flagship, Kommende Mailberg Malteser Ritterorden, pairs Cabernet Sauvignon with Merlot in a structured red wine. These wines have been assessed by Falstaff, Decanter, Wine Spectator, and Wine Enthusiast, reflecting the winery's engagement with international critical evaluation. The range demonstrates the region's capacity for both classical European red blends and the mineral-driven white wines for which Austria has become recognized.
